MongoDB, Inc. (NASDAQ: MDB), a leading database for modern applications, has announced its acquisition of Voyage AI, a pioneer in state-of-the-art embedding and reranking models for next-generation AI applications. The integration of Voyage AI’s technology with MongoDB aims to enable organizations to build trustworthy AI-powered applications by offering highly accurate and relevant information retrieval deeply integrated with operational data.
Voyage AI’s advanced embedding and reranking models are designed to extract meaning from highly specialized and domain-specific text and unstructured data, ranging from legal and financial documents to images, code, and enterprise knowledge bases. Notably, Voyage AI's embedding models are the highest-rated zero-shot models in the Hugging Face community, and the company is trusted by leading AI innovators like Anthropica, Langchain, Harvey, and Replit.
The acquisition is positioned to address the limitations of AI applications due to the risk of "hallucinations" caused by inaccurate or low-quality results. This is especially critical in use cases where the accuracy of information is paramount, such as in healthcare, finance, and legal sectors. MongoDB's CEO, Dev Ittycheria, emphasized that the combination of MongoDB and Voyage AI aims to redefine the requirements of databases for the AI era, aiming to enable enterprises to build trustworthy AI-powered applications that drive meaningful business impact.
Tengyu Ma, founder of Voyage AI, highlighted that for AI applications to reach their full potential, businesses must trust their outputs, requiring accurate and relevant retrieval deeply integrated with operational data. By joining MongoDB, Voyage AI aims to bring its cutting-edge AI retrieval technology to a broader audience and integrate it seamlessly into mission-critical applications.
Voyage AI’s embedding and reranking models will remain available through Voyage.AI, AWS Marketplace, and Azure Marketplace, with further MongoDB integrations expected to launch later this year.
